A088934 Maximum prime required for the representation of n by a signed sum of squares of distinct primes that has the minimal number of terms A088910(n). +0
4
19, 13, 19, 13, 2, 3, 13, 19, 13, 3, 13, 7, 5, 3, 13, 7, 5, 13, 13, 7, 5, 5, 19, 13, 7, 5, 13, 13, 7, 5, 5, 19, 13, 7, 5, 13, 7, 7, 5, 13, 7, 17, 11, 11, 7, 7, 17, 11, 13, 7, 17, 11, 13, 7, 7, 17, 11, 13, 7, 11, 11, 7, 7, 11, 13, 7, 17, 11, 11, 7, 7, 17, 11, 13, 7, 17, 11, 11, 7, 7, 17, 11 (list; graph; listen)
